About Us
Ashrey Farms was founded in 2007 in Decatur County in beautiful Southwest Georgia. Ashrey is a Hebrew word meaning blessed. The 24-acre organic blueberry farm is located on a 1600-acre nature preserve, which is managed intensely for native plants, game and timber. Both partners, Mike Grimsley and Wesley Popiel, discovered that they have a passion for organic farming. With Mike’s business background and Wes’s crop science background, their talents complimented each other well, and they decided to start this exciting venture.













Ashrey Farms includes several varieties of blueberries. There is 3 acres of early highbush ripening from mid-April to mid-May. Three varieties of rabbiteye bushes make up the remaining 21-acres and ripen from mid-May to late June. This spring/summer is the blueberries’ third growing season. A 2000 square foot packing shed was constructed this spring and allows the blueberries to be packed and refrigerated on-site.
Ashrey Farms has produced beautiful blueberries this year and will continue to grow with additional organic produce planned for the future.


Mike is originally from Bainbridge, GA where Ashrey Farms is located. He graduated from the University of Georgia and co-owns a development company based in Atlanta, GA. Wesley moved to the area 11 years ago from Athens, GA. He also graduated from UGA with a crop science degree. He currently owns and operates a wildlife management company.
